Produktbeschreibung
Future Directions of Educational Change brings together timely discussions on social justice, professional capital, and systems change from some of the leading scholars in the field of education. Engaging in theory and evidence-based debates covering issues such as literacy education, whole system reform, and teacher leadership, this volume argues that quality and equity are equally important in reshaping existing education systems both within the United States and globally. The authors offer contextual analyses of current educational research and practice while looking toward the future and offering thought-provoking arguments for challenging and rectifying the systemic inequalities within education today.
Autorenporträt
Helen Janc Malone is the director of education policy and institutional advancement and the national director of the Education Policy Fellowship Program at the Institute for Educational Leadership, USA. Santiago Rincón-Gallardo is a visiting scholar at the Ontario Institute for Studies in Education, Canada, and chief research officer at Michael Fullan Enterprises Inc. Kristin Kew is an assistant professor of educational leadership and management at New Mexico State University, USA.
